We are receiving a lot of messages daily asking us when we will be reopening the fishery. The truth is that we really don’t know yet. As a business we are following government guidelines and we have a duty of care to our customers and the local community. Whilst it is not safe to risk anglers mixing or have our bailiffs doing their rounds, we will not be reopening the fishery. Our advice on the current health situation Some large events of over 100 people are being cancelled nationwide but as it stands there is currently no reason to close our lakes due to the type and style of sporting activity that we offer. All of our fishing swims are at least three metres apart and fishing is an ideal sole activity with low risk. You really can’t beat the fresh air, lovely scenery, time to relax and unwind. Netting on Monday saw a small team of our bailiffs, plus a couple of helpful volunteers gather down at the lakes in anticipation of seeing a net full of fish. Aiming to net a ‘sample’ of lake 5 due to excess brambles and rough margins the netting was a success. Due to news of devastating predation at other local fishing venues we were keen to find out how our stock levels were in lake 5, especially on the smaller side of species as there was plenty of fry seen in the lake last summer.
